在当代数字化界面中,小组件这一称谓,特指那些能够嵌入操作系统桌面、应用程序界面或特定信息面板中的微型功能模块。其核心价值在于,无需用户启动完整的应用程序,便能直接提供关键信息的实时预览或执行某些快捷操作。例如,在智能手机的主屏幕上,一个天气小组件可以直观展示当前的温度、湿度与未来几小时的预报;而在电脑的侧边栏,一个日历小组件则能快速提醒用户接下来的日程安排。这些模块化的设计,极大地提升了用户获取信息与执行任务的效率,是构建个性化与高效率数字工作环境的重要元素。
从技术实现层面剖析,小组件的本质是一种轻量级的应用程序视图或功能片段。它通常由应用程序开发者提供,作为主程序功能的延伸与精简展示。其运行机制依赖于操作系统或宿主平台提供的特定框架与接口,从而能够在有限的屏幕空间内,实现数据的动态获取、处理和可视化呈现。这种设计哲学体现了“信息前置”与“即用即走”的理念,旨在减少用户的操作层级,将最常用的功能或最关心的数据直接呈现在触手可及的位置。 小组件的形态与功能呈现出丰富的多样性。依据其核心作用,可以大致划分为几个主要类别。信息展示型小组件专注于数据的呈现,如新闻摘要、股票行情或系统性能监控;功能控制型小组件则提供快捷操作入口,例如音乐播放控制、智能家居开关或笔记速记;此外,还有复合型小组件,它将信息展示与简单操作融为一体,例如一个待办事项列表小组件,既能显示任务条目,也允许用户直接勾选完成。这种分类方式有助于我们理解小组件在设计目的与用户体验上的不同侧重。 在用户体验与界面设计领域,小组件扮演着日益重要的角色。它不仅是功能性的工具,更是用户进行界面个性化定制的核心载体。用户可以根据自己的使用习惯和审美偏好,自由选择、摆放和组合不同的小组件,从而打造出独一无二的数字空间。这种高度的可定制性,使得小组件超越了单纯的工具属性,成为连接用户与数字世界、表达个人风格与提升数字生活品质的一个关键节点。小组件的概念溯源与核心定义
要深入理解“小组件”这一概念,有必要追溯其发展脉络。这一设计理念的雏形,可以追溯到早期计算机操作系统中的“桌面附件”或“控制面板项目”。然而,真正使其普及并形成现代范式,得益于二十一世纪初网页技术中“微件”概念的兴起,以及随后移动操作系统将其系统性地整合进主屏幕。从广义上讲,小组件是一种封装了特定功能或信息内容的、可独立运行的轻量化软件单元。它并非一个完整的应用程序,而是应用程序功能的子集或特定视图,通过操作系统提供的标准化容器和通信接口,嵌入到宿主环境(如桌面、锁屏、负一屏)中运行。其最显著的特征在于实时性、交互性与空间占用最小化。它能够持续或按需从网络、本地数据库或传感器获取最新数据并更新显示,同时允许用户在组件界面上直接进行有限但高效的操作,所有这一切都发生在一个相对固定且紧凑的屏幕区域内。 小组件的技术架构与运行原理 小组件的实现依赖于一套由操作系统或平台方定义的完整技术框架。这套框架通常包括几个关键部分:首先是声明与描述机制,开发者需要在一个配置文件中明确小组件的元信息,如尺寸规格、更新频率、所需权限以及初始布局;其次是视图渲染引擎,负责将数据模型按照定义的样式绘制到屏幕上,现代系统多采用声明式UI语法来简化这一过程;第三是生命周期管理,系统会严格管控小组件的创建、更新、暂停和销毁,以平衡功能与设备资源(如电量、内存)的消耗;最后是数据通信桥梁,小组件通过进程间通信或共享数据区的方式,与其背后的主应用程序或远程数据源进行同步。例如,一个邮件小组件可能通过系统提供的定时服务唤醒,向邮件服务器请求未读邮件数量,然后更新其界面显示,整个过程主邮件应用可能并未在前台运行。 小组件的多元化分类体系 根据不同的维度,小组件可以划分为多种类型,这有助于我们从多角度把握其生态全貌。按照功能目的划分,是最主流的分类方式:信息速览类小组件,如天气、日历、股票、新闻头条,其核心是高效传递动态信息;快捷操作类小组件,如计算器、录音机、手电筒开关、智能家居场景按钮,旨在提供一键直达的便利;娱乐媒体类小组件,如音乐播放器、播客控件、短视频推荐流,聚焦于内容的控制与发现;效率工具类小组件,如待办清单、计时器、笔记摘录、系统资源监视器,服务于个人的时间与任务管理。按照交互深度划分,可分为静态展示型、轻度交互型(如翻页、按钮)和深度交互型(如在小部件内进行复杂滑动输入)。按照数据来源划分,则可分为依赖网络数据的云端小组件、依赖本地数据的设备小组件以及混合型小组件。 小组件的设计哲学与用户体验价值 小组件的流行,深刻反映出现代交互设计中的“原子化”与“场景化”趋势。其设计哲学核心在于降低信息获取成本与缩短任务完成路径。传统应用模式需要用户经历“找到图标-点击启动-等待加载-导航至目标页面”的多步流程,而小组件将最终目标直接外露,实现了“零层级”访问。从用户体验角度看,它的价值体现在多个层面:在效率层面,它化繁为简,是生产力提升的利器;在个性化层面,它赋予用户前所未有的桌面布局自主权,使设备界面成为个人数字身份的外延;在场景感知层面,智能小组件能够根据时间、地点、活动状态(如连接耳机)自动推荐或切换显示内容,实现更贴心的情景式服务。然而,这也对设计者提出了挑战,需要在有限的空间内进行清晰的信息层级排布和直观的交互设计,避免因信息过载或操作晦涩而适得其反。 小组件的生态现状与发展前瞻 当前,小组件已成为各大操作系统(如苹果的iOS、谷歌的Android、微软的Windows)以及众多应用软件的标准配置,形成了一个活跃的开发者生态。应用商店中拥有海量的小组件选择,覆盖了从生活到工作的方方面面。展望未来,小组件的发展将呈现几个清晰的方向:一是智能化与预测性,借助人工智能,小组件不仅能展示信息,还能预测用户意图并提前准备相关功能或内容;二是跨设备与无缝流转,同一个小组件状态可以在手机、平板、电脑甚至智能手表间同步和接力;三是交互形态的演进,随着折叠屏、卷轴屏等新硬件的出现,小组件的尺寸和形态可能更加灵活可变;四是更深度的系统集成,未来小组件或许能突破应用沙盒限制,实现更强大的跨应用协作功能。总之,小组件作为用户与数字世界交互的最前沿触点之一,其形态与内涵将持续进化,在提升人机交互效率和愉悦感方面发挥越来越关键的作用。
381人看过